Transaction 9203da35cd874f81d757497a40f259e5a13f3f5f3ee47e69db539f3ddf43d54e

5 Input
1 Outputs
  • 9203da35cd874f81d757497a40f259e5a13f3f5f3ee47e69db539f3ddf43d54e:0
  • value  6089304
    address  1KmCksgy74E9AhLwR4uBnsBvS8jq3fftgN